The blower set must be stored in its original packaging in a
dry place and must be protected against dust. Compact
units in the acoustic enclosure intended for outside use can
be stored in the open air. If the blower set has been stored
for more than six months, you should (re)preserve it. For
this purpose, you can use standard preservative agents.
Storage conditions:
Temperature: -30 °C up to 40 °C
Relative humidity: up to 80%


3. I

NSTALLATION AND ASSEMBLY

Assembly in the Open Air
To install the blower set (the set including the enclosure) in
the open air, you must consider the local conditions (snow,
possibility of flooding, etc.)

Service passages and the space necessary for the set
assembly in the machine hall are shown in Appendix 3.
Acoustic enclosures designed for outside use also serve as
weather protection.

Assembly in the machine hall
The minimum dimensions of the machine hall are based on
the maximum dimensions of the compact unit (acoustic
enclosure) and the necessary 1-metre (better 1.2-metre)
operation space at the sides of the blowers (enclosures) and
between the blowers (enclosures). They are further based
on the 1.2-metre space between the wall of the discharge
section at the acoustic enclosure and the wall. The machine
hall height depends on the method chosen for handling the
machine(s).

When designing the machine hall, you must remember the
openings for the blower sets (the delivered sets are
normally assembled). The acoustic enclosure are
demountable. You should consider equipping the machine
hall with an overhead track for a crane crab or leaving
enough space for a forklift truck in order to handle those
blower sets to be maintained or repaired (necessity to
dismantle the blower and/or motor if a failure has
occurred).
The space necessary for installation of individual types of
SHARK blower sets can be derived from the dimensions
stated in the dimensional drawings.

The floor designed for installation must be flat and
dimensioned for the machine weight and anchor length.
With respect to the loading capacity, no special
requirements are stipulated for the floor design since both
the blowers and motors are dynamically balanced. The
mechanical oscillation power of the blowers and motors are
stated in Tables 3 and 4. The weight of the blower set is
distributed between its individual bases. The weight of the
delivered blower set is stated in its appropriate dimensional
drawing.
The blower set must be positioned horizontally by placing
plates under the machine bases. The permitted deviation is
1 mm for 1 metre.

WARNING

After being set in its position, the blower set must
be anchored to the floor.
Otherwise, it could move
spontaneously and thus be damaged.


Working procedure for anchoring compact units and
acoustic enclosures.
1. Drill a hole and clean it;
2. Stick the anchor into the hole; and
3. Tighten the nut.

The space and diameters of the base holes are stated in the
enclosed dimensional drawing of the compact unit. The
procedure for anchoring acoustic enclosures is the same.
You should, however, pay attention to the tightness of the
gap between the hood and the floor. After setting the hoods
in their positions, you must also level any floor unevenness
in order to prevent the sidewalls from being tight. In order
to seal the gap between the hood and the floor, you can
apply polyurethane foam, for example. The electric cable
must be laid in the floor.
If you intend to put a blower set in the hood on a half grid,
you must order a non-standard enclosure because the
bottoms of the acoustic enclosures are not soundproof.

Connecting the pipeline to the SHARK compact unit
Since the entire aggregate is placed on rubber dampers, the
pipeline must be connected through flexible elements.
Otherwise, the running blower could shake the pipeline,
thus increasing the noise level. Standard compact units are
delivered with compensators for connection of the
discharge section. If a SHARK blower for vacuum is been
required or intended to be connected to the central suction,
a compensator for connection of suction is also supplied.
Delivered compensators and valves of larger blower sets
supplied with acoustic enclosures (from the K 302 type) are
not installed. These parts must be installed behind the
outlet flange of the discharge silencer or also in front of the
inlet flange of the suction silencer according to the
following pictures:
